What does journeyman mean?

noun

A skilled craftsman or tradesman who has completed an apprenticeship and is qualified to work independently, but is not yet a master of the trade. A person who has experience and skill in a particular field or activity.

Example

"The carpenter was a journeyman who had worked on many projects, but was still learning from his master."
